I am a native of Northern California with lifelong interests in astronomy, philosophy, and computer applications. Much to my delight, I found opportunities to pursue all of these simultaneously in support of Charles Francis' recent research. I first became interested in Relational Quantum Gravity upon learning how the Teleconnection uniquely solves the Pioneer Anomaly and the Galactic Rotation Problem. I was immediately inspired to gain a deeper understanding of why the Teleconnection works and how its effects might potentially be revealed through pre-established observations of stars in our own Galaxy. My ongoing contributions include illustrations and diagrams, importing online astronomical databases for analysis, the co-development of kinematic analyses of local populations of stars, and assiting the development of this website.
